Renault Arkana: Renault is set to launch its new car, the Renault Arkana, which aims to compete with the Tata Nexon in the Indian market. The Renault Arkana will come equipped with new and exciting features, including a powerful engine.

One of the standout features of the Renault Arkana is its powerful engine. The car is expected to feature a 1.3-liter petrol engine that also incorporates mild hybrid technology. This engine option will be available with both manual and automatic transmission variants. Renault already offers this engine in its international models.

In terms of design, the Renault Arkana boasts a sleek and stylish exterior. The car features LED headlights and a touchscreen infotainment system with smartphone connectivity. The interior of the car is also impressive, with leather seats and a range of other standard and safety features.

As for the price, details about the Renault Arkana’s pricing in India have not been released. However, it is estimated that the car could be priced at around 10 lakh rupees or more. The starting price of the car in India could be as low as 7 lakhs. The Renault Arkana will compete with other popular SUVs in the Indian market, including the Hyundai Venue, Maruti Brezza, Mahindra XUV300, Tata Nexon, and Kia Sonet.
